Some retired senior military officers have backed the death sentence passed on 12 soldiers of the Nigerian Army for committing mutiny. The officers told SUNDAY PUNCH that it was necessary for the military to maintain its age-long rules on discipline. There are strong indications that efforts of the Federal Government to ensure amicable settlement of issues surrounding the $9.3m seized by South Africa have failed. South Africa’s National Prosecuting Authority, in an email to our correspondent in Abuja on Thursday, said that the matter was still under criminal investigations. THE Arewa Consultative Forum (ACF) has labelled the administration of President Goodluck Jonathan a failure. The pan-Northern organisation, in an open letter to the president, issued to journalists in Kaduna, on Sunday, said the state of insecurity in the region had deteriorated under the watch of the Presidency.
